Product Description:

The PMB31B-20101-00 is a brushless servomotor produced by Pacific Scientific in the PMB Brushless Servomotors series. It converts electrical energy into controlled rotary motion for indexing tables, pick-and-place heads, and other position-critical axes used in automated machinery. The motor is intended for compact servo systems where permanent-magnet efficiency supports limited installation space. By supplying continuous torque without brushes, the unit reduces maintenance needs and provides commutation signals for closed-loop velocity and position control in general industrial automation. Its operating profile suits machinery that depends on repeatable starts, stops, and directional changes throughout normal cycle operation.

Mechanically, the frame conforms to the NEMA Size 34 outline, so the bolt pattern and pilot diameter match many standard servo gearheads and brackets. When stalled at rated temperature, the winding draws 2.7 ARMS from a 240 VAC supply. All phase, ground, and sensor conductors exit as flying leads with AMP connectors, which allows connection without opening the motor housing. Rotor position feedback is supplied by an integrated Hall sensor that generates three square-wave signals for six-step commutation. The unit is built as a standard motor, with no special coatings, windings, or bearing changes.

The output shaft uses a square key, providing positive torque transmission to pulleys or couplings without relying on friction alone. Active magnetic length uses a stack length multiple of 1, which is the shortest option and helps reduce rotor inertia during rapid starts and stops. The short magnetic stack supports quick speed changes on indexing moves and other repetitive positioning tasks. The keyed shaft and electronic feedback make the motor suitable for controlled motion where stable commutation and repeatable acceleration are required. This arrangement is useful in compact axes that need responsive motion without a large motor envelope.
